Output ce5a108217c5a8c6055c893ccaa7ba54d3a42c0307cffe4e9ca81662d9c703da:0

value
23269567
script pubkey
OP_0 OP_PUSHBYTES_20 31772bcc1fd4a2100570c765f22172ea93f7ac6d
address
bc1qx9mjhnql6j3pqptscajlygtja2fl0trdn38ymc
transaction
ce5a108217c5a8c6055c893ccaa7ba54d3a42c0307cffe4e9ca81662d9c703da